Danny M. Gable

Danny M. GableDanny M. Gable of Iowa City, Iowa – Mr. Gable is currently Assistant to the Director of Athletics at the University of Iowa after stepping down as head wrestling coach in 1997 after 21 years in that position. During his tenure as head coach, Mr. Gable became known as the University of Iowa's "all-time winningest wrestling coach," with a career record of 355-21-5, all at Iowa. A former Gold medal winner himself in wrestling (1972 Summer Olympics – Munich, Germany), Mr. Gable was head coach for the 1980, 1984 and 2000 Olympic wrestling teams and assistant freestyle coach for the 1976 and 1988 Olympics. In 1980, he was named to the U.S.A. Wrestling Hall of Fame and in 1985 was inducted into the U.S. Olympic Hall of Fame. In addition to his coaching duties, Mr. Gable also aids the University of Iowa in their fund-raising efforts and promotes the sport of wrestling world-wide. Mr. Gable holds a B.S. in Biology and Physical Education from Iowa State University.
